1923 (3 June)
Chinese red-band cover with red "Moorea Oceania" departure pmk, date filled-in by hand, arriving in Papeete 5 June, charged 10c in blue crayon, with the addition of diagonal half of 1fr postage due, paying 50c postage due. Since the inter-Colonial
rate was 25c, it is possible that the cover came from outside the Colony, arriving in Moorea and then sent to Papeete. The 50c due represents double the deficiency and there was a shortage of 50c postage dues, fine (Image)
